The FDA-cleared product non-invasively fragments stones in the kidney or ureter in fully awake patients.
August 3, 2026
By: Michael Barbella
SonoMotion said its Break Wave pivotal S.O.U.N.D clinical trial has met its co-primary efficacy and safety endpoints.
Break Wave uses low-pressure focused ultrasound to fragment kidney stones by creating standing stress waves within the stone under real-time ultrasound image guidance. The procedure is completely non-invasive and requires no anesthesia or sedation, allowing patients to drive themselves to and from the procedure and eat and drink before the procedure.
Kidney stones affect one in 10 people in the United States, costing $10 billion annually and resulting in more than 750,000 lithotripsy procedures per year.1
“Kidney stones are incredibly disruptive, causing severe pain, impacting renal function, reducing health-related quality of life, and often requiring individuals and their caregivers to take time off school and work,” said Ryan Hsi, M.D., associate professor of Urology at the University of California, Irvine. “The Break Wave device represents the only anesthesia-free and ionizing radiation-free option to treat kidney stones in a variety of healthcare settings, which means it can be delivered to patients where they need it. Since it is non-invasive, it will allow patients to recover quickly and return to their busy lives.”
The U.S. Food and Drug Administration cleared SonoMotion’s original and next-generation Break Wave devices. The latest version features therapy probes with a 31% smaller footprint and a significantly lighter weight.
“Meeting our pivotal trial endpoints while receiving FDA clearance for a more compact device puts us in a strong position to bring Break Wave to the millions of patients who suffer from kidney stones each year,” SonoMotion Co-Founder/CEO Oren Levy, Ph.D., stated. “We are proud of the team for continuously improving the technology, and are delighted to offer a truly non-invasive, anesthesia-free treatment that patients need and deserve.”
A venture capital-backed startup based in San Mateo, Calif., SonoMotion is a commercial medical technology company developing next-generation, noninvasive solutions for kidney stone treatment.
